Bookmark handmade in Teak taken from HMS Britannia, former training ship moored at Dartmouth from 1869 until towed away and broken up in 1916.

The wood to make the pen was obtained from a book stand made originally when the ship was broken up in 1916. A lot of the wood from broken ships was used to make souvenirs. I have so far seen Ink wells Desk pen stands, tables and book cases made with the wood from HMS Britannia and also a number of other ships broken around the same time.
